did: Mat 27:30; Num 12:14; Deu 25:9; Job 30:9-11; Isa 50:6, Isa 52:14, Isa 53:3; Mar 14:65, Mar 15:19; Co1 4:13; Heb 12:2 buffeted him: Εκολαφισαν \[Strong's G2852\], "smote him with their fists," as Theophylact interprets. and others: Mat 5:39; Kg1 22:24; Jer 20:2; Lam 3:30, Lam 3:45; Luk 22:63; Joh 18:22, Joh 19:3; Act 23:2, Act 23:3; Co2 11:20, Co2 11:21 smote him: Ερραπισαν \[Strong's G4474\], "smote him on the cheek with the open hand," as Suidas renders. They offered him every indignity, in all its various and vexatious forms. the palms of their hands: or, rods, Mic 5:1 Matthew 26:68
